Hutch is an Internet and Telecommunication Service Provider in Sri Lanka, offering affordable mobile plans, reliable network coverage, and excellent customer service. Their product range includes various data and call packages, prepaid and postpaid plans, and specialized services like Child Safe Internet and mobile money solutions. Targeting both individual consumers and enterprises, Hutch aims to provide seamless connectivity and innovative solutions for everyday needs. With a commitment to sustainability and community engagement, Hutch continues to enhance its offerings to meet the demands of its diverse clientele.

Founded in 1894, Comporium Communications is a local telephone, internet, cable and home security provider that centrally operates in York and Lancaster counties in the north-central section of South Carolina.
